BRATWURST STEWED WITH SAUERKRAUT
Wisconsin may be the cheese state, but bratwurst (ground meat sausages that are grilled, or in this case, pan-fried) are the state's culinary claim to fame. Due largely to residents' German ancestry, brats are a common site at butcher shops, restaurants and even baseball stadiums. (Madison, Wisconsin is home to an annual "Brat Fest") Michael Symon's simple recipe calls for the links to be cooked with onions, garlic and tangy sauerkraut and then served on a baguette.
Provided by Michael Symon : Food Network
Categories main-dish
Time 1h15m
Yield 8 to 10 servings
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- In a large pan, heat oil over high heat. Brown bratwurst in oil and reduce heat to medium. Add onions and garlic and cook until lightly caramelized. Add stock, paprika, caraway seeds, and sauerkraut and simmer for 45 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in fresh dill. Serve on baguette.

BRATWURST IN SOUR CREAM SAUCE
Make and share this Bratwurst in Sour Cream Sauce rec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Sackville
Categories Meat
Time 32m
Yield 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Put the sausage into boiling water, remove from the heat and let soak for 5 minutes.
- Drain and pat dry with paper towels.
- Melt the butter over moderate heat in a large frying pan, add the bratwurst and cooking, turning often until they are brown on all sides.
- Add the water, lower the heat and simmer uncovered for 15-20 minutes.
- Add more water if needed.
- Put the sausages on a plate and cover.
- Beat the flour and salt into the sour cream.
- Add into the liquid remaining in the skillet.
- Cook over a low heat, stirring, for 5-8 minutes until the sauce is slightly thickened and smooth.
- Do not boil.
- Serve over the bratwurst, either whole or sliced.

SARASOTA'S SO-CALLED CROCKPOT BEER BRATWURST & VEGGIES
This is nothing fancy and just true comfort food. A family style platter of slow cooked carrots, onions, potatoes, bratwurst and sauerkraut, all braised in a beer broth. The crock pot works great for this or you can use any oven proof pot as well. Just a little chopping, a bottle of beer, some seasoning and you are set. Before serving, I do like to take a little of the cooking liquid, cool for a few minutes and add some sour cream, horseradish, and stone ground mustard to make a great warm sauce for the brats and vegetables.
Provided by SarasotaCook
Time 6h10m
Yield 8 , 8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 19
Steps:
- Chop -- Simply cut the brats in 3 pieces each on a angle. Carrots, peel, again chop on a angle (I just like how it looks) in about 2" pieces. Onion, I use 2 large onions, rough chopped. Potatoes, small ones I leave whole, if they are large I will cut in half. Not too small or they get mushy.
- Crockpot -- Brats on the bottom with the carrots, then onions and topped with potatoes. Top all that with the sauerkraut.
- Sauce -- In a small bowl or measuring cup, add the butter and melt in the microwave for 10 seconds, remove and then add in the beer, mustard, bay leaf, 1 teaspoon black pepper and garlic. Pour over the brats and vegetables. Lay 3 springs of thyme right on top of the sauerkraut.
- Cook -- Crockpot - low 6-8 hours. My crock pot takes 7 hours, but every crockpot is different. You just want the potatoes and carrots to be tender. The brats will easily be done. Right at the end of cooking, check for seasoning. No salt was added, but the sauerkraut even though it was rinsed can be salty, so go easy. Besides you are serving a sauce with this dish which also has seasoning.
- Sauce -- This is a great compliment to this dish. You can always just serve it with some mustard, but I love this sauce served on each persons plate in a small side bowl for dipping or for pouring over the vegetables. It is similar to the consistency of gravy.
- Remove the cooking liquid to let it cool slightly before you add it to the sour cream so it does not break the sour cream. It will cool in just a few minutes. In a small bowl add the sour cream, horseradish, mustard, salt and pepper. It is a nice creamy spicy sauce to serve with the brats and vegetables. My Mom always adds more mustard to her portion, so just go by taste. I happen to love my horseradish sauce, so -- each person is unique in their own taste.

BRATWURST IN SOUR CREAM SAUCE RECIPE | MYRECIPES
From myrecipes.com
Servings 6
- Fill a large Dutch oven half full of water; bring to a boil. Place bratwurst in boiling water; cover and remove from heat. Let stand 5 minutes. Drain well, and pat dry.
- Melt butter in a heavy skillet over low heat; add bratwurst, and cook, turning frequently, until browned. Add 1/2 cup water; simmer, uncovered, 15 minutes. Slice bratwurst into 1/4-inch pieces, and remove to a warm serving platter. Set skillet aside with pan drippings.
- Combine sour cream, flour, and salt, stirring well. Add sour cream mixture to reserved pan drippings; stir until smooth. Cook over low heat, stirring constantly, 5 minutes, or until mixture is slightly thickened. Add bratwurst slices to sour cream sauce; cook over low heat until thoroughly heated. Serve immediately.
